Difficulty Opening or Closing Your Mouth
Experiencing difficulty opening or shutting your mouth is a clear indicator that you ought to get in touch with a dental cosmetic surgeon immediately. This sign can be an indication of various underlying oral wellness issues that require prompt focus.
Below are 5 feasible reasons for your problem in opening or shutting your mouth:
- Temporomandibular Joint (TMJ) Condition: TMJ problem impacts the joint that connects your jawbone to your skull. It can create discomfort and rigidity, making it challenging to move your jaw.
- Lockjaw: Tetanus, also referred to as trismus, is a condition where the jaw muscles spasm and prevent normal mouth opening.
- Dental Cancer: Difficulty in mouth activity can be a very early sign of dental cancer. It's essential to get it examined by a dental cosmetic surgeon.

Loose or Shifting Pearly Whites
If you see your teeth becoming loose or changing, it's crucial to get in touch with an oral doctor immediately. This could be a sign of a serious oral concern that needs punctual interest. Right here are some reasons that loose or changing teeth shouldn't be neglected:
- Injury or injury: Teeth can become loosened as a result of a blow to the mouth or face. An oral cosmetic surgeon can examine the damage and offer suitable treatment.
- Gum condition: Advanced gum illness can trigger the supporting structures of the teeth to compromise, causing tooth wheelchair. A dental cosmetic surgeon can examine the extent of the illness and advise treatment options.
- Dental cavity: Extreme degeneration can weaken the integrity of the tooth, triggering it to become loosened. A dental surgeon can determine the best course of action.
- Bite problems: Misaligned teeth or an inappropriate bite can create teeth to move or come to be loose. A dental doctor can deal with these problems and avoid additional damage.
- Bone loss: In some cases, bone loss in the jaw can cause teeth to end up being loose. An oral surgeon can analyze the scenario and provide proper treatment to bring back stability.
Hitting or Standing Out Jaw Joint
Do you experience a clicking or popping sensation in your jaw joint? This could be an indication that you require to seek advice from an oral specialist immediately.
Clicking or appearing the jaw joint, additionally referred to as the temporomandibular joint (TMJ), can show a problem with the joint's alignment or feature. It may be caused by problems such as TMJ problem, arthritis, or a displaced disc in the joint.
This clicking or popping can result in pain, pain, and difficulty in opening up or shutting your mouth. If left without treatment, it can get worse and affect your life.
